TC declares that the legislator does not have to take inflation into account in calculating real estate earnings in personal income tax.

The General Assembly Meeting of the Constitutional Court has started. Andalusian Supreme Court of Justice rejected the question of unconstitutionality raised by the Contested-Administrative ChamberCeuta and Melilla amended article 21 of article 1 of the personal income tax law of 2014, and The legislator does not have to take inflation into account. to calculate real estate earnings in personal income tax.

The question raised the question of whether the principle of economic capacity in Article 31.1 of the Constitution is valid. required the law to be taken into account. inflation Determining the amount of capital gains arising from the transfer of real estatethus fully nominal capital gains are not taxed.

In the particular case under consideration, The State Tax Administration had claimed personal income tax on real estate gains arising from the transfer of property acquired in 1995 and sold in 2016.without updating the purchase value according to the evolution of the price index between the two years.

However, it applied the wording of article 35.2 of the Income Tax Law in the 2014s.removed the update coefficients of the acquisition value of properties that were in effect until then. The sentence begins from the fact that what is stated is unconstitutional by omission, and that this can only be understood as produced if the Constitution itself imposes the need to dictate certain rules of constitutional development to the legislator and the legislator fails to do so. The economic capacity doctrine

He then recalls the constitutional doctrine on the principle of economic capacity, in which he declared the system of calculating the tax base on the increase in the value of urban land (municipal capital gains) in 2021 unconstitutional. The principle is not only that all taxes are based on a real budget that demonstrates economic capacity, but also that requests that the tax liability be quantified accordingly. However, this second aspect of the legislator a large margin of freedom to determine the amount of tax, according to the criteria of reasonableness and proportionality. The printing of update coefficients for real estate in 2014 was based on the fact that the only item of personal income tax that takes into account the evolution of prices, without justifying this singular treatment, is property earnings.

This emerged in the Report of the committee of experts for tax system reform prepared in February 2014, a few months before the reform under review. Regarding inflation adjustments, TC, referring to the municipal capital gains tax, denied in a precedent that this should be calculated taking into account inflation in any case.. In this case, he ensured that the nominalist principle was consistent with the constitutional order, and that only in “extreme situations” of “particularly acute” inflation would the legislator need to act to prevent inflationary erosion from adversely affecting the principle of economic capacity.

The Court considers the economic situation before and after the 2014 reform, with an average annual inflation of 2.37% for the period 2004-2014 and 1.80% for the period 2014-2023, far from being characterized as “extreme” or “particularly acute”. Likewise, he stresses that the rule under trial cannot be analyzed alone, but rather in conjunction with the rest of the personal income tax provisions that provide preferential treatment to real estate gains over other incomes as they are taxed at lower rates. more than income, salary or work, and also enjoy certain exemptions when they come from their habitual residence.

Reflecting the wide margin that the legislator must recognize in this area, subsequent personal income tax adjustments Many different options for inflation adjustmentdoes not apply to all, some, or none of capital gains over time. The same conclusion is drawn from the analysis of personal income tax in other regions with autonomy in this regard. While inflation adjustment continues to apply for both real estate and other heritage items in the Basque Country, in Navarra it has not been foreseen for any as it has been in the common region since the aforementioned Law No. 26/2014.

The decision concludes It is not possible to deduce from the economic capacity principle that the legislator always and in any case has the obligation to foresee the updating of the acquisition value of the immovables.by separating real estate gains through a special inflation adjustment that does not apply to any other element of personal income tax or other taxes on capital gains such as municipal capital gains or corporate income tax. This is a legitimate option that can be challenged in terms of political or legal expediency, but does not constitute a state of unconstitutionality by omission.

individual votes

The judiciary has individual opinions of judges Ricardo Enríquez Sancho and Enrique Arnaldo Alcubilla. They think that the reform of the calculation of capital gains in personal income tax, carried out by Law No. 26/2014, makes the mere difference between an asset’s value at acquisition and its value at transfer reveal a delicate economic capacity. to taxation, unknownErosion of the snow by the tyranny of time (inflation) purely monetary to the point where they may not have actually occurred, they may well have done so, but for less than nominally stated.

In this way, they anticipate that with this reform, far from taxing any real economic capacity, citizens will be taxed wholly or partially for non-existent manifestations of wealth, in clear contradiction with both the principle of economic capacity and the tax system. . only those specified in art. 31.1 EC. According to that, taxation only in the common lands is not, once again, much more burdensome than in the historical lands of the Basque autonomous community.however, it falls outside current trends in OECD countries in general and in our environment in particular (eg Germany, France, Italy, Luxembourg or Portugal).
